How they compare
Bulgaria currently reports 0.3 kilograms per year per capita against 0.27 kilograms per year per capita in Austria, a difference of 0.03 kilograms per year per capita.
That makes Bulgaria's figure about 1.1 times Austria's.
The two have swapped places 13 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Austria ahead.
Austria ranks 53rd and Bulgaria ranks 50th of 184 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Austria averaged higher in 6 and Bulgaria in 1.
